CHAPTER 5 Security Setup
2
Enter a send destination.
• Up to 16 trap send destinations can be set.
• Set a community or user name and the IP address of the trap transfer destination,
an SNMP version, and certification level.

3
Click the [Apply] button.
Click the [Test Trap] button to send a test trap to the trap send destination that is
currently set.

Specifies a community name or user name.
Remarks: Any of the following characters can be used:
Specifies the IP address of the trap transfer destination.
Used to select an SNMP version.
• 1: A version-1 SNMP trap is sent.
• 2: A version-2 SNMP trap is sent.
• 3: A version-3 SNMP trap is sent.
Used to select an authentication level.
• noauth: Disables authentication and encryption based on a
password (enables authentication based on a user name).
• auth: Enables authentication based on a password but
disables encryption based on a password.
• priv: Enables authentication and encryption based on a
password.
• md5: Selects MD5 as the hash function for password-based
encryption.
• sha: Selects SHA as the hash function for password-based
encryption.
Displays the packet encryption keyword used at the time of
password-based authentication (no password-based
encryption).
Displays the packet encryption keyword used at the time of
password-based authentication and encryption.
